Output 7d8657450068bec2f157ac41e74de1fd1e06a251471cb5c28f61ec1e6c4ec28d:0

value
87658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a77e91c3381f41a0bcd0c995cec7fe5b74ce034e OP_EQUAL
address
3GxePmsc5Fws5kHuXQN83rXXBgCTnkA5cj
transaction
7d8657450068bec2f157ac41e74de1fd1e06a251471cb5c28f61ec1e6c4ec28d
confirmations
338992
spent
true